|
Investments and Fair Value Measurements - Investments in Accordance with Fair Value Hierarchy (Detail) (USD $)
In Thousands, unless otherwise specified
|
Dec. 31, 2014
|
Dec. 31, 2013
|
Dec. 31, 2012
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|$ 423,355us-gaap_AssetsFairValueDisclosure
|$ 235,235us-gaap_AssetsFairValueDisclosure
|
|Contingent consideration, current and noncurrent
|12,277us-gaap_LossContingencyAccrualAtCarryingValue
|21,052us-gaap_LossContingencyAccrualAtCarryingValue
|38,050us-gaap_LossContingencyAccrualAtCarryingValue
|Self-insurance
|1,369us-gaap_SelfInsuranceReserve
|2,554us-gaap_SelfInsuranceReserve
|1,375us-gaap_SelfInsuranceReserve
|Liabilities
|13,646us-gaap_LiabilitiesFairValueDisclosure
|23,606us-gaap_LiabilitiesFairValueDisclosure
|
|Money Market Funds [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|25,841us-gaap_AssetsFairValueDisclosure
/ us-gaap_InvestmentTypeAxis
= us-gaap_MoneyMarketFundsMember
|52,595us-gaap_AssetsFairValueDisclosure
/ us-gaap_InvestmentTypeAxis
= us-gaap_MoneyMarketFundsMember
|
|U.S. Government and Sponsored Entities [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|139,206us-gaap_AssetsFairValueDisclosure
/ us-gaap_InvestmentTypeAxis
= efii_UsGovernmentSecuritiesAndSponsoredEntitiesMember
|28,909us-gaap_AssetsFairValueDisclosure
/ us-gaap_InvestmentTypeAxis
= efii_UsGovernmentSecuritiesAndSponsoredEntitiesMember
|
|Corporate Debt Securities [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|233,758us-gaap_AssetsFairValueDisclosure
/ us-gaap_InvestmentTypeAxis
= us-gaap_CorporateDebtSecuritiesMember
|117,195us-gaap_AssetsFairValueDisclosure
/ us-gaap_InvestmentTypeAxis
= us-gaap_CorporateDebtSecuritiesMember
|
|Municipal Securities [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|2,376us-gaap_AssetsFairValueDisclosure
/ us-gaap_InvestmentTypeAxis
= us-gaap_MunicipalBondsMember
|17,377us-gaap_AssetsFairValueDisclosure
/ us-gaap_InvestmentTypeAxis
= us-gaap_MunicipalBondsMember
|
|Asset-Backed Securities [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|19,266us-gaap_AssetsFairValueDisclosure
/ us-gaap_InvestmentTypeAxis
= us-gaap_AssetBackedSecuritiesMember
|14,236us-gaap_AssetsFairValueDisclosure
/ us-gaap_InvestmentTypeAxis
= us-gaap_AssetBackedSecuritiesMember
|
|Mortgage-Backed Securities - Residential [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|2,908us-gaap_AssetsFairValueDisclosure
/ us-gaap_InvestmentTypeAxis
= efii_MortgageBackedSecuritiesResidentialMember
|4,923us-gaap_AssetsFairValueDisclosure
/ us-gaap_InvestmentTypeAxis
= efii_MortgageBackedSecuritiesResidentialMember
|
|Quoted Prices in Active Markets for Identical Assets (Level 1) [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|89,132us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
|65,307us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
|
|Quoted Prices in Active Markets for Identical Assets (Level 1) [Member] | Money Market Funds [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|25,841us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
/ us-gaap_InvestmentTypeAxis
= us-gaap_MoneyMarketFundsMember
|52,595us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
/ us-gaap_InvestmentTypeAxis
= us-gaap_MoneyMarketFundsMember
|
|Quoted Prices in Active Markets for Identical Assets (Level 1) [Member] | U.S. Government and Sponsored Entities [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|63,291us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
/ us-gaap_InvestmentTypeAxis
= efii_UsGovernmentSecuritiesAndSponsoredEntitiesMember
|12,712us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el1Member
/ us-gaap_InvestmentTypeAxis
= efii_UsGovernmentSecuritiesAndSponsoredEntitiesMember
|
|Significant other Observable Inputs (Level 2) [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|333,969us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
|169,827us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
|
|Significant other Observable Inputs (Level 2) [Member] | U.S. Government and Sponsored Entities [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|75,915us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_InvestmentTypeAxis
= efii_UsGovernmentSecuritiesAndSponsoredEntitiesMember
|16,197us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_InvestmentTypeAxis
= efii_UsGovernmentSecuritiesAndSponsoredEntitiesMember
|
|Significant other Observable Inputs (Level 2) [Member] | Corporate Debt Securities [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|233,758us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_InvestmentTypeAxis
= us-gaap_CorporateDebtSecuritiesMember
|117,195us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_InvestmentTypeAxis
= us-gaap_CorporateDebtSecuritiesMember
|
|Significant other Observable Inputs (Level 2) [Member] | Municipal Securities [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|2,376us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_InvestmentTypeAxis
= us-gaap_MunicipalBondsMember
|17,377us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_InvestmentTypeAxis
= us-gaap_MunicipalBondsMember
|
|Significant other Observable Inputs (Level 2) [Member] | Asset-Backed Securities [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|19,012us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_InvestmentTypeAxis
= us-gaap_AssetBackedSecuritiesMember
|14,135us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_InvestmentTypeAxis
= us-gaap_AssetBackedSecuritiesMember
|
|Significant other Observable Inputs (Level 2) [Member] | Mortgage-Backed Securities - Residential [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|2,908us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_InvestmentTypeAxis
= efii_MortgageBackedSecuritiesResidentialMember
|4,923us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_InvestmentTypeAxis
= efii_MortgageBackedSecuritiesResidentialMember
|
|Unobservable Inputs (Level 3) [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|254us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
|101us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
|
|Contingent consideration, current and noncurrent
|12,277us-gaap_LossContingencyAccrualAtCarryingValue
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
|21,052us-gaap_LossContingencyAccrualAtCarryingValue
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
|
|Self-insurance
|1,369us-gaap_SelfInsuranceReserve
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
|2,554us-gaap_SelfInsuranceReserve
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
|
|Liabilities
|13,646us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
|23,606us-gaap_LiabilitiesF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
|
|Unobservable Inputs (Level 3) [Member] | Asset-Backed Securities [Member]
|
|
|
|Investments And Fair Value Measurements [Line Items]
|
|
|
|Total Investments
|$ 254us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_InvestmentTypeAxis
= us-gaap_AssetBackedSecuritiesMember
|$ 101us-gaap_AssetsFairValueDisclosure
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el3Member
/ us-gaap_InvestmentTypeAxis
= us-gaap_AssetBackedSecuritiesMember
|